    What to do if Enertech EAV060 Heat Pump has low hot water temperature?
    • M
      morganamyAug 10, 2025
      If you experience low hot water temperature with your Enertech Heat Pump, it may be due to large hot water consumption. In this case, wait until the hot water has heated up. Also, check whether alarm “high condenser out” (162) is displayed, and if so, inspect and clean the strainer.

    Why is Enertech EAV060 producing low room temperature in heating?
    • B
      Bradley MullinsAug 17, 2025
      If your Enertech Heat Pump is producing low room temperature during heating, it could be due to several reasons. First, check if thermostats are off in several rooms and set them to max in as many rooms as possible. Also, check whether alarm “high condenser in” (163) or “high condenser out” (162) are displayed. If so, follow the instructions for adjusting flow rate.

    What to do if there is ice build-up in Enertech Heat Pump?
    • D
      Danielle ReynoldsAug 26, 2025
      If you notice ice build-up in the fan, grille, or fan cone on the outdoor module of your Enertech Heat Pump, the de-icing fan may not be activated. To resolve this, activate the “de-icing fan” in menu 5.11.1.1.

    What to do if EAV is not in operation in Enertech EAV060?
    • S
      Stephanie NorrisSep 1, 2025
      If the EAV (Electronic Expansion Valve) is not in operation in your Enertech Heat Pump, ensure that the EAV is connected to the power source and that compressor operation is required. Also, check that the addressing of EAV is correct and that the communication cable has been connected.
